What the data shows

Bletchley and Stantonbury recorded very similar overall crime levels in April 2026 — 186 and 163 incidents respectively. The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Bletchley sees higher rates of Anti-social behaviour (23) and Criminal damage & arson (20), while Stantonbury has more Shoplifting (30) and Vehicle crime (18). Both areas sit near the national average, with modest differences in their overall safety profile.
